Subject: Roof-terrace door — repeated jamming

Hi Facilities team,

The roof-terrace door at Fennaby Tower has jammed three times this week, twice trapping staff outside briefly. It appears the latch plate has shifted; the door needs a firm shoulder push, which is wearing the frame. Could someone inspect it before the weekend event? Until repaired, please use the maintenance stairwell instead. The stairwell keypad code is below.

staff pass of kawip-hawef = bdg-QLP-2

Building Access — Night Shift (Support Team)

The support team at Marrow Point works 22:00–06:00 and enters through the east stairwell, as the main lobby is locked overnight. Team assistants should confirm rosters with security by 17:00 each day. Overnight staff can open the east stairwell door using the code below.

badge for fafop-fajof: bdg-Z-47

Owner: platform on-call. Quorum: three keyholders present. Verify the Dedupler alert-deduplication service is drained before rotation; suppressed alert groups must flush first or pages duplicate on restart. Record ceremony start time, witness names, and HSM serial in the log. Generate new signing key, re-sign the dedup rule bundle, redeploy to staging, confirm alert collapse rates match baseline. If the legacy key escrow must be opened during the ceremony, unseal it with the recovery passphrase below.

unlock words, tawif-tahop: oliys-ulawyn-tamdor-lamys-casox-jormir-fraius-kasath-ulador-ulamir-holir-sorys-holeth